Larry Potash: Chicago TV news anchor reflects on his career and shares journalism tips
Episode 15 is out now! I’m thrilled to announce my guest: Larry Potash A 14-time Emmy winner, Larry is the co-anchor of WGN’s Morning News, the top-rated morning TV news show in Chicago. He started his anchoring career with WGN in 1995 and is an iconic TV personality in Illinois, having reported on news in Chicago and beyond for more than a quarter-century. His documentary series, “Backstory with Larry Potash,” explores tales of history, religion, culture, and science. Larry came to WGN from Tulsa, Oklahoma, where he had worked as a weekend anchor and political reporter. Before that, he was at WFIE-TV in Evansville, Indiana, and at KLMG-TV in Longview, Texas. He says he is living his dream and couldn’t picture himself doing anything else. In this episode, Larry shares insights from his decades of experience in the news business. Whether you are just starting out as a journalist or a seasoned news professional, this is a MUST-listen episode. The information is so valuable and his advice has guided me throughout my career. Nathalie Basha: Life as a travel journalist & digital storytelling tips
Nathalie Basha is a Webby nominated digital journalist. Her stories are centered around travel and culture. She’s traveled to more than 30 countries documenting the people and places she encounters. Nathalie produces, films, writes, edits, and reports her own content. Her YouTube Channel called, “The Travel Muse” has thousands of subscribers, and millions view her content. Nathalie's stories include covering a women’s prison in Colombia and a sacred Māori tattoo ceremony in New Zealand. She uncovered the abuses in elephant tourism in Southeast Asia, trekked to an isolated mountain town on the Georgia/Russia border to report on a local family, and visited Pablo Escobar’s mansion-turned-theme park in Colombia. Ever wonder what it would be like to get paid to travel the world? Nathalie and I discuss the journey that led to her dream role. She doesn’t hold back the struggles and setbacks. Listen in to hear what life is like for a successful journalist living outside the box! She also shares tips and her favorite production gear.

Ruben Santa: Thoughts on landing his dream job at Google and being a UX designer for YouTube
Ever wonder what it would be like to work for Google and Youtube? Well, Ruben Santa is the man with the answers. Santa is rounding out his 6th year working for Google. He is a User Experience Designer for Youtube (Google is the parent company of YouTube). He focuses on designing the main app on mobile and web. This means he helps design the page you land on when you watch YouTube videos. In this episode we discuss Ruben’s journey getting into the design world, the setbacks he faced while achieving his title at Google, and life after all of his success. Santa also shares job interviewing tips that helped land him his first job with the company. Previously, Santa worked at major companies including: Sony, Warner Bros., IDEO, eBay and the United Nations. Listen in to hear how he earned his title and how you could land a job like his.
